435 double phiIMassMin = 0.85;
436 double phiIMassMax = 1.20;
437 double phiIPtMin = 18.0;
438 double phiIEtaMax = -1.0;
439 double phiIYMax = -1.0;
440 double phiBMassMin = 0.85;
441 double phiBMassMax = 1.20;
442 double phiBPtMin = 14.0;
443 double phiBEtaMax = -1.0;
444 double phiBYMax = 1.25;
445 double jPsiIMassMin = 2.80;
446 double jPsiIMassMax = 3.40;
447 double jPsiIPtMin = 25.0;
448 double jPsiIEtaMax = -1.0;
449 double jPsiIYMax = -1.0;
450 double jPsiBMassMin = 2.80;
451 double jPsiBMassMax = 3.40;
452 double jPsiBPtMin = 20.0;
453 double jPsiBEtaMax = -1.0;
454 double jPsiBYMax = 1.25;
455 double psi2IMassMin = 3.40;
456 double psi2IMassMax = 4.00;
457 double psi2IPtMin = 18.0;
458 double psi2IEtaMax = -1.0;
459 double psi2IYMax = -1.0;
460 double psi2BMassMin = 3.40;
461 double psi2BMassMax = 4.00;
462 double psi2BPtMin = 10.0;
463 double psi2BEtaMax = -1.0;
464 double psi2BYMax = 1.25;
465 double upsIMassMin = 8.50;
466 double upsIMassMax = 11.0;
467 double upsIPtMin = 15.0;
468 double upsIEtaMax = -1.0;
469 double upsIYMax = -1.0;
470 double upsBMassMin = 8.50;
471 double upsBMassMax = 11.0;
472 double upsBPtMin = 12.0;
475 double upsBEtaMax = -1.0;
476 double upsBYMax = 1.4;
478 double oniaProbMin = 0.005;
479 double oniaCosMin = -2.0;
480 double oniaSigMin = -1.0;
482 double oniaMuPtMinLoose = 2.0;
483 double oniaMuPtMinTight = -1.0;
484 double oniaMuEtaMaxLoose = -1.0;
485 double oniaMuEtaMaxTight = -1.0;
497 new BPHDaughterSelect(oniaMuPtMinLoose, oniaMuPtMinTight, oniaMuEtaMaxLoose, oniaMuEtaMaxTight, sms);
501 double npJPsiPtMin = 8.0;
502 double npJPsiEtaMax = -1.0;
503 double npJPsiYMax = -1.0;
504 double npMuPtMinLoose = 4.0;
505 double npMuPtMinTight = -1.0;
506 double npMuEtaMaxLoose = 2.2;
507 double npMuEtaMaxTight = -1.0;
514 double buIMassMin = 0.0;
515 double buIMassMax = 999999.0;
516 double buIPtMin = 27.0;
517 double buIEtaMax = -1.0;
518 double buIYMax = -1.0;
521 double buIJPsiPtMin = 25.0;
522 double buIJPsiEtaMax = -1.0;
523 double buIJPsiYMax = -1.0;
524 double buIProbMin = 0.15;
525 double buICosMin = -2.0;
526 double buISigMin = -1.0;
545 double buDMassMin = 0.0;
546 double buDMassMax = 999999.0;
547 double buDPtMin = 10.0;
548 double buDEtaMax = -1.0;
549 double buDYMax = -1.0;
552 double buDJPsiPtMin = 8.0;
553 double buDJPsiEtaMax = -1.0;
554 double buDJPsiYMax = -1.0;
555 double buDProbMin = 0.10;
556 double buDCosMin = 0.99;
557 double buDSigMin = 3.0;
578 double bdIMassMin = 0.0;
579 double bdIMassMax = 999999.0;
580 double bdIPtMin = 27.0;
581 double bdIEtaMax = -1.0;
582 double bdIYMax = -1.0;
585 double bdIJPsiPtMin = 25.0;
586 double bdIJPsiEtaMax = -1.0;
587 double bdIJPsiYMax = -1.0;
590 double bdIKx0PtMin = -1.0;
591 double bdIKx0EtaMax = -1.0;
592 double bdIKx0YMax = -1.0;
593 double bdIProbMin = 0.15;
594 double bdICosMin = -2.0;
595 double bdISigMin = -1.0;
613 double bdDMassMin = 0.0;
614 double bdDMassMax = 999999.0;
615 double bdDPtMin = 10.0;
616 double bdDEtaMax = -1.0;
617 double bdDYMax = -1.0;
620 double bdDJPsiPtMin = 8.0;
621 double bdDJPsiEtaMax = -1.0;
622 double bdDJPsiYMax = -1.0;
625 double bdDKx0PtMin = -1.0;
626 double bdDKx0EtaMax = -1.0;
627 double bdDKx0YMax = -1.0;
628 double bdDProbMin = 0.10;
629 double bdDCosMin = 0.99;
630 double bdDSigMin = 3.0;
650 double bsIMassMin = 0.0;
651 double bsIMassMax = 999999.0;
652 double bsIPtMin = 27.0;
653 double bsIEtaMax = -1.0;
654 double bsIYMax = -1.0;
657 double bsIJPsiPtMin = 25.0;
658 double bsIJPsiEtaMax = -1.0;
659 double bsIJPsiYMax = -1.0;
662 double bsIPhiPtMin = -1.0;
663 double bsIPhiEtaMax = -1.0;
664 double bsIPhiYMax = -1.0;
665 double bsIProbMin = 0.15;
666 double bsICosMin = -2.0;
667 double bsISigMin = -1.0;
685 double bsDMassMin = 0.0;
686 double bsDMassMax = 999999.0;
687 double bsDPtMin = 10.0;
688 double bsDEtaMax = -1.0;
689 double bsDYMax = -1.0;
692 double bsDJPsiPtMin = 8.0;
693 double bsDJPsiEtaMax = -1.0;
694 double bsDJPsiYMax = -1.0;
697 double bsDPhiPtMin = -1.0;
698 double bsDPhiEtaMax = -1.0;
699 double bsDPhiYMax = -1.0;
700 double bsDProbMin = 0.10;
701 double bsDCosMin = 0.99;
702 double bsDSigMin = 3.0;
722 double b0IMassMin = 0.0;
723 double b0IMassMax = 999999.0;
724 double b0IPtMin = 27.0;
725 double b0IEtaMax = -1.0;
726 double b0IYMax = -1.0;
729 double b0IJPsiPtMin = 25.0;
730 double b0IJPsiEtaMax = -1.0;
731 double b0IJPsiYMax = -1.0;
734 double b0IK0sPtMin = -1.0;
735 double b0IK0sEtaMax = -1.0;
736 double b0IK0sYMax = -1.0;
737 double b0IProbMin = 0.15;
738 double b0ICosMin = -2.0;
739 double b0ISigMin = -1.0;
757 double b0DMassMin = 0.0;
758 double b0DMassMax = 999999.0;
759 double b0DPtMin = 10.0;
760 double b0DEtaMax = -1.0;
761 double b0DYMax = -1.0;
764 double b0DJPsiPtMin = 8.0;
765 double b0DJPsiEtaMax = -1.0;
766 double b0DJPsiYMax = -1.0;
769 double b0DK0sPtMin = -1.0;
770 double b0DK0sEtaMax = -1.0;
771 double b0DK0sYMax = -1.0;
772 double b0DProbMin = 0.10;
773 double b0DCosMin = 0.99;
774 double b0DSigMin = 3.0;
794 double lbIMassMin = 0.0;
795 double lbIMassMax = 999999.0;
796 double lbIPtMin = 27.0;
797 double lbIEtaMax = -1.0;
798 double lbIYMax = -1.0;
801 double lbIJPsiPtMin = 25.0;
802 double lbIJPsiEtaMax = -1.0;
803 double lbIJPsiYMax = -1.0;
806 double lbILambda0PtMin = -1.0;
807 double lbILambda0EtaMax = -1.0;
808 double lbILambda0YMax = -1.0;
809 double lbIProbMin = 0.10;
810 double lbICosMin = -2.0;
811 double lbISigMin = -1.0;
822 new BPHFittedBasicSelect(lbILambda0MassMin, lbILambda0MassMax, lbILambda0PtMin, lbILambda0EtaMax, lbILambda0YMax);
830 double lbDMassMin = 0.0;
831 double lbDMassMax = 999999.0;
832 double lbDPtMin = 10.0;
833 double lbDEtaMax = -1.0;
834 double lbDYMax = -1.0;
837 double lbDJPsiPtMin = 8.0;
838 double lbDJPsiEtaMax = -1.0;
839 double lbDJPsiYMax = -1.0;
842 double lbDLambda0PtMin = -1.0;
843 double lbDLambda0EtaMax = -1.0;
844 double lbDLambda0YMax = -1.0;
845 double lbDProbMin = 0.10;
846 double lbDCosMin = 0.99;
847 double lbDSigMin = 3.0;
858 new BPHFittedBasicSelect(lbDLambda0MassMin, lbDLambda0MassMax, lbDLambda0PtMin, lbDLambda0EtaMax, lbDLambda0YMax);
868 double bcIMassMin = 0.0;
869 double bcIMassMax = 999999.0;
870 double bcIPtMin = 27.0;
871 double bcIEtaMax = -1.0;
872 double bcIYMax = -1.0;
875 double bcIJPsiPtMin = 25.0;
876 double bcIJPsiEtaMax = -1.0;
877 double bcIJPsiYMax = -1.0;
878 double bcIJPsiProbMin = 0.005;
879 double bcIProbMin = 0.10;
880 double bcICosMin = -2.0;
881 double bcISigMin = -1.0;
882 double bcIDistMin = 0.01;
902 double bcDMassMin = 0.0;
903 double bcDMassMax = 999999.0;
904 double bcDPtMin = 8.0;
905 double bcDEtaMax = -1.0;
906 double bcDYMax = -1.0;
909 double bcDJPsiPtMin = 7.0;
910 double bcDJPsiEtaMax = -1.0;
911 double bcDJPsiYMax = -1.0;
912 double bcDJPsiProbMin = 0.005;
913 double bcDProbMin = 0.10;
914 double bcDCosMin = 0.99;
915 double bcDSigMin = 3.0;
938 double x3872IMassMin = 0.0;
939 double x3872IMassMax = 999999.0;
940 double x3872IPtMin = 27.0;
941 double x3872IEtaMax = -1.0;
942 double x3872IYMax = -1.0;
945 double x3872IJPsiPtMin = 25.0;
946 double x3872IJPsiEtaMax = -1.0;
947 double x3872IJPsiYMax = -1.0;
948 double x3872IJPsiProbMin = 0.10;
949 double x3872IProbMin = 0.10;
950 double x3872ICosMin = -2.0;
951 double x3872ISigMin = -1.0;
952 double x3872IDistMin = 0.01;
964 x3872IJPsiMassMin, x3872IJPsiMassMax, x3872IJPsiPtMin, x3872IJPsiEtaMax, x3872IJPsiYMax);
974 double x3872DMassMin = 0.0;
975 double x3872DMassMax = 999999.0;
976 double x3872DPtMin = 8.0;
977 double x3872DEtaMax = -1.0;
978 double x3872DYMax = -1.0;
981 double x3872DJPsiPtMin = 7.0;
982 double x3872DJPsiEtaMax = -1.0;
983 double x3872DJPsiYMax = -1.0;
984 double x3872DJPsiProbMin = 0.10;
985 double x3872DProbMin = 0.10;
986 double x3872DCosMin = 0.99;
987 double x3872DSigMin = 3.0;
998 x3872DJPsiMassMin, x3872DJPsiMassMax, x3872DJPsiPtMin, x3872DJPsiEtaMax, x3872DJPsiYMax);
CandidateSelect * bsIJPsiBasicSelect
CandidateSelect * buDVertexSelect
CandidateSelect * bsDPhiBasicSelect
CandidateSelect * lbDJPsiDaughterSelect
CandidateSelect * jPsiBBasicSelect
CandidateSelect * bcDVertexSelect
CandidateSelect * x3872IJPsiBasicSelect
CandidateSelect * bcDJPsiBasicS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> sdCandsToken
CandidateSelect * bsIBasicSelect
CandidateSelect * bdDKx0BasicSelect
CandidateSelect * phiIBasicSelect
CandidateSelect * lbIJPsiBasicSelect
CandidateSelect * b0DVertexSelect
CandidateSelect * bcIBasicSelect
CandidateSelect * buIJPsiBasicSelect
CandidateSelect * jPsiIBasicSelect
CandidateSelect * bdIKx0BasicSelect
CandidateSelect * bcDBasicSelect
CandidateSelect * buDJPsiDaughterSelect
CandidateSelect * bdDVertexSelect
CandidateSelect * x3872IVertexSelect
CandidateSelect * lbDJPsiBasicSelect
CandidateSelect * bsDJPsiDaughterSelect
CandidateSelect * psi2BBasicSelect
std::string trigResultsLabel
CandidateSelect * buIBasicSelect
CandidateSelect * bdIJPsiBasicSelect
CandidateSelect * npJPsiDaughterS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> bcCandsToken
CandidateSelect * bcDJPsiVertexSelect
CandidateSelect * buDBasicSelect
static const double jPsiMass
CandidateSelect * lbDVertexS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> bdCandsToken
std::string x3872CandsLabel
static const double k0sMass
CandidateSelect * b0IBasicSelect
CandidateSelect * bsIJPsiDaughterSelect
CandidateSelect * b0DBasicSelect
CandidateSelect * bsDVertexSelect
CandidateSelect * x3872IJPsiDaughterSelect
CandidateSelect * bsDJPsiBasicS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> bsCandsToken
CandidateSelect * bdDJPsiBasicSelect
static const double kx0Mass
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> lbCandsToken
CandidateSelect * x3872DJPsiVertexS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> x3872CandsToken
CandidateSelect * lbDBasicSelect
std::string oniaCandsLabel
CandidateSelect * bsIVertexSelect
CandidateSelect * x3872IBasicSelect
CandidateSelect * oniaDaughterSelect
CandidateSelect * lbIJPsiDaughterSelect
CandidateSelect * npJPsiBasicSelect
CandidateSelect * b0IVertexSelect
CandidateSelect * bdIBasicSelect
CandidateSelect * bdDJPsiDaughterSelect
BPHTokenWrapper< edm::TriggerResults > trigResultsToken
static const double lambda0Mass
CandidateSelect * lbIBasicSelect
CandidateSelect * x3872DBasicSelect
static const double phiMass
CandidateSelect * x3872IJPsiVertexSelect
CandidateSelect * bsDBasicSelect
CandidateSelect * buDJPsiBasicSelect
CandidateSelect * lbILambda0BasicSelect
CandidateSelect * bcDJPsiDaughterSelect
CandidateSelect * buIJPsiDaughterSelect
CandidateSelect * b0DJPsiBasicS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> l0CandsToken
CandidateSelect * bdIVertexSelect
CandidateSelect * psi2IBasicSelect
CandidateSelect * upsBBasicS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> k0CandsToken
CandidateSelect * oniaVertexSelect
CandidateSelect * bdDBasicSelect
CandidateSelect * b0IK0sBasicSelect
CandidateSelect * b0IJPsiBasicS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> b0CandsToken
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> ssCandsToken
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> buCandsToken
CandidateSelect * bcIVertexSelect
CandidateSelect * bcIJPsiDaughterSelect
CandidateSelect * lbIVertexSelect
BPHTokenWrapper< std::vector< pat::CompositeCandidate > > oniaCandsToken
CandidateSelect * lbDLambda0BasicSelect
CandidateSelect * bdIJPsiDaughterSelect
CandidateSelect * b0DJPsiDaughterSelect
CandidateSelect * bcIJPsiBasicSelect
CandidateSelect * b0IJPsiDaughterSelect
CandidateSelect * x3872DJPsiDaughterSelect
CandidateSelect * phiBBasicSelect
CandidateSelect * bcIJPsiVertexSelect
CandidateSelect * x3872DVertexSelect
CandidateSelect * bsIPhiBasicSelect
#define SET_LABEL(NAME, PSET)
CandidateSelect * upsIBasicSelect
CandidateSelect * b0DK0sBasicSelect
CandidateSelect * x3872DJPsiBasicSelect
CandidateSelect * buIVertexSelect